Jeremy was told that his cancer could not be treated with radiotherapy and must be treated with chemotherapy. This is probably because the cancer is...

If he has to have his cancer treated with chemotherapy it means that the cancer has spread. Radiotherapy is usually used when it is in just one area and has not spread yet.
